Explorar o código

打印查询推送数据响应时间

zhangdongming hai 1 ano
pai
achega
e72fb7270e
Modificáronse 1 ficheiros con 3 adicións e 0 borrados
  1. 3 0
      Service/DevicePushService.py

+ 3 - 0
Service/DevicePushService.py

@@ -95,6 +95,7 @@ class DevicePushService:
         @param event_type: 事件类型
         @return: uid_push_qs
         """
+        start_time = time.time()
         if event_type not in [606, 607]:
             uid_push_qs = UidPushModel.objects.filter(uid_set__uid=uid, uid_set__detect_status=1). \
                 values('token_val', 'app_type', 'appBundleId', 'm_code', 'push_type', 'userID_id', 'userID__NickName',
@@ -110,6 +111,8 @@ class DevicePushService:
                        'lang', 'm_code', 'tz', 'uid_set__nickname', 'uid_set__detect_interval', 'uid_set__detect_group',
                        'uid_set__channel', 'uid_set__ai_type', 'uid_set__device_type', 'uid_set__new_detect_interval',
                        'uid_set__msg_notify', 'jg_token_val')
+        end_time = time.time()
+        LOGGING.info(f'{uid}查询推送token耗时:{end_time-start_time}ms')
         return uid_push_qs
 
     @staticmethod